Improve message about failed transaction log archiving

The old phrasing appeared to imply that the failure was terminal.
Improve that by indicating that archiving will be tried again later.
This commit is contained in:
Peter Eisentraut 2013-04-26 22:43:54 -04:00
parent b53b603c91
commit f5d576c6d2

View file

@ -503,7 +503,7 @@ pgarch_ArchiverCopyLoop(void)
if (++failures >= NUM_ARCHIVE_RETRIES)
{
ereport(WARNING,
(errmsg("transaction log file \"%s\" could not be archived: too many failures",
(errmsg("archiving transaction log file \"%s\" failed too many times, will try again later",
xlog)));
return; /* give up archiving for now */
}